We came to Tucson and had some time to kill. We stumbled upon this hidden gem and it did not disappoint. We ordered two carne asada caramelos along with two tacos, one carne asada and one cabeza. The food completely exceeded our expectations. Everything was fresh, flavorful, and perfectly cooked. We also tried the Jamaica drink, which my fiancé really enjoyed.
